About Federation University Australia
As Australia’s leading regional university, the desire to transform lives, enhance communities and build a strong and sustainable university informs everything we do.
We became Federation University Australia in 2014 – a new entity bringing together almost 150 years of history making us as one of the oldest universities in Australia.
We have campuses in Victoria across Ballarat, Berwick, Gippsland and the Wimmera, as well as vocational and trade education at our Victorian TAFE campuses.
We are a diverse community with over 18,500 domestic and international students, 1,650 staff and 118,000 alumni across Australia and the world.
